Meeting notes — Records Team, weekly sync

Attendees reviewed the pending transfer of the crate of survey instruments returned from the Dunhollow ridge project. Inventory confirmed: two levels, one total station, tripods, all belonging to Ferrant Geomatics. The crate stays in the secure annex until collection. Condition photos were taken and filed by Ysolde. Collection is booked with Pettibone Couriers for Thursday morning. The agreed instruction for the courier hand-over is recorded directly below this entry.

handover note for yagef-bagep: the drudor pelius courier leaves the kasdor zorvan norir ledger at gate 8016 under passcode 755406

## Changelog — extract-strings rotation (Pellgrove i18n tooling)

For the weekly sync: we rotated the signing key used by the translation-string extraction script after the old one expired on schedule. Extraction output pushed to the Lintwell string registry is now signed with the replacement key; the registry rejects artifacts signed with the retired key as of Monday. CI runners were updated automatically, but local runs need a manual config change. The new signing key is below.

rollout seal: bky4_DFM9

Subject: Contrast audit cut-over — done!

Hi plugin folks,

The Lumabright contrast audit wrapped up Friday, and we've cut over to the new palette tokens. If your plugin still references the legacy grays, things may look washed out on the Tidemark theme. Swap to the semantic tokens before the next release. Here are the values the audit service now enforces.

deployment values, kajep-kageg:
[praix]
host = praix.paliqcorp.corp
user = praix_svc
database = praix_prod

# Tasklantern migration — env file header
#
# We replaced the homegrown Quillqueue job runner with Tasklantern.
# Plugin authors: your jobs now enqueue via the Tasklantern client;
# the old QUEUE_DIR and QUEUE_POLL_MS vars are dead and ignored.
# Set TASKLANTERN_CONCURRENCY (default 4) and TASKLANTERN_RETRY_MAX (default 3)
# to tune worker behavior. Dead-letter handling is automatic now, so remove
# any custom sweeper plugins. The client authenticates to the broker
# using the credential defined on the following line:

sealed setting: ARCHIVE_KEY3=8d0